This Man is a Champ!!! Triumphant Olympic Moment

Derek Redmond, assisted by his dad, dragged himself to the finish line after pulling a hamstring in the 400-meter dash during the 1992 Olympics. This hurts, a lot.

I got this from Slate, criticizing the Morgan Freeman narrated version/commercial for visa:

"He," says Freeman, pausing dramatically as violins groan loudly in the background, "and his father"—another pause, with the violins growing more insistent—"finished dead last"—pause, two-second-long freeze frame on Redmond's agonized face—"but he"—pause—"and his father"—pause—"finished."
